About SolarEdge, Solar Batteries

SolarEdge solar batteries review

SolarEdge is an Israeli company best known for manufacturing solar inverters and power optimisers, but it has recently branched out into manufacturing battery storage.

Formally launched in Australia in late March 2022, the SolarEdge Home Battery offers 9.7 kilowatt-hours of usable storage and can crank 5 kilowatts of continuous power.

A DC coupled energy storage solution, it is backup capable - but that requires extra equipment and therefore extra cost. A SolarEdge Energy Hub single phase inverter and a Backup Box is needed for backup functionality. Use without backup requires either a SolarEdge HD-Wave Genesis or HD-Wave EV inverter.

On a related note, the company doesn't recommend this battery be used for off-grid applications.

The system can be installed indoors or outdoors and wall or floor mounted; with the latter requiring the purchase of a floor mount.

The SolarEdge Home Battery warranty is pretty good compared to some other manufacturers - 10 years and unlimited cycles.

A Unique Battery Safety Feature

In terms of safety, this battery sysytem has a really interesting feature - a built in fire extinguisher that will engage should the internal temperature rise too high. But prior to this happening, the system will alert SolarEdge and the owner to a heat issue requiring attention.

With an ounce of prevention being worth a pound of cure, this is a really good idea as once that extinguisher is in a situation where it engages, the battery will be pretty much toast. But thanks to this intervention, hopefully not thoroughly burnt toast taking the home with it.

We were initially undecided about getting a battery because of the cost. However we are glad we did. The only time we need to draw from the grid is during winter when we run the reverse cycle heating which will drain the battery (9.7kWh) by about 8.30pm. The rest of the year is not a problem.
